Privacy Policy for the Diário do Professor app

This policy covers the Android app Diário do Professor (br.com.rmportotech.profdiario), published by RM Porto Tech on Google Play. The app itself is available in Brazilian Portuguese only. It does not replace the website privacy policy, which covers rmportotech.com.br.

Summary

The app collects no data at all. It runs entirely offline, makes no network requests, has no sign-up or login, shows no ads and contains no analytics or tracking of any kind. Everything you record stays on your device. RM Porto Tech never receives, sees or stores anything you type into the app.

What is stored on your device

The app keeps a local database inside its private storage area on Android, holding: the classes you create and their rules (passing average, minimum attendance, number of terms, scheduled lessons), the student list with the name and roll number you type, attendance records per lesson, the assessments of each term and the grades you enter.

These records never leave the device on the app's initiative. There is no server, no user account and no synchronisation.

What the app does not do

  • It makes no network requests. The app behaves identically with the device in flight mode.
  • It has no account, login, password or social integration.
  • It contains no ads, no analytics, no third-party SDKs and no tracking of any kind.
  • It does not access location, contacts, camera, microphone, calendar, photos or personal files.
  • It does not collect advertising identifiers or device information.
  • It sends no crash reports and no usage statistics.

Permissions

The app requests no sensitive Android permission — no permission prompt appears at any point. The package declares only automatic permissions inherited from the libraries it uses: network access, which the app never exercises, vibration, used for the haptic feedback when marking attendance, and an internal permission Android requires for the app to deliver notices to itself. None of them grants access to your data.

Exporting reports

The app produces PDF and spreadsheet files from your own records. The file is created locally and handed to the Android share sheet, where you choose the destination: save it on the device, send it by e-mail, open it in another app. The app never uploads the file anywhere and never picks a destination for you.

Once you choose a destination, handling is governed by whichever app or service you selected. Since these files contain student names and grades, the destination deserves the same care you would give a printed class list.

Android backup

The app allows Android to include its data in the device's automatic backup — the same mechanism that preserves your other apps' data when you switch phones. That backup is performed by the operating system to the Google account configured on the device, under Google's terms, and never passes through RM Porto Tech. You can turn it off in the Android backup settings.

Security

Data lives in the app's private storage, an area Android isolates from other installed apps. With no transmission there is no data in transit to intercept, and with no server there is no central database that could leak. Device protection — screen lock and Android encryption — is what guards these records, and it is worth keeping it on.
